In the role of Senior Backend Engineer on the Global Accounts team, you will take ownership of vital components of our bank account platform. You will be involved in the design and development of a fully distributed, event-driven system built for scalability, resilience, and compliance. Your primary development language will be Kotlin, with opportunities to work with Elixir and Golang. We embrace Extreme Programming methodologies: frequent iterations, daily releases, and a strong emphasis on technical excellence and deep problem-solving. Our tech stack includes Kotlin, Golang, Elixir, Java, AWS, Kafka, PostgreSQL, and Kubernetes, complemented by observability tools such as Prometheus, Grafana, and Honeycomb. We also leverage AI-assisted development tools like Cursor and GitHub Copilot.
